What is a Galvo Controller?

A galvo controller is an electronic device that manages galvanometer systems. These systems convert electrical signals into precise mirrored movements that guide laser beams to specific coordinates. The result is enhanced accuracy and speed in various applications, including engraving, cutting, and marking.

How Galvo Controllers Enhance Laser Efficiency

Integrating a reliable galvo controller into your laser setup can significantly enhance overall performance. These controllers allow for faster response times and smoother movements, making it possible to achieve intricate designs without sacrificing speed. With features such as real-time feedback, they adapt to changes in the workflow, providing immediate corrections to maintain precision.

Choosing the Right Galvo Controller

Selecting the right galvo controller is crucial for maximizing the benefits mentioned above. Consider factors such as compatibility with existing laser systems, the speed of response, and the level of support provided by the manufacturer. High-quality controllers come with additional features, such as customizable settings and advanced software interfaces, that can further streamline operations.
